About This Opportunity

The Accounting Alumni Gold Medal Award for Excellence in Accounting is a prestigious annual award presented to the outstanding graduate from the Master of Accounting program at the University of Waterloo. One gold medal is awarded annually, usually in October, to the student who has achieved the highest marks in all required and elective accounting courses throughout their program. The award recognizes academic excellence and outstanding achievement in the field of accounting at the graduate level. The gold medal has a monetary value that varies from year to year, and the award is made possible through generous donations from Accounting alumni of the University of Waterloo. Recipients are automatically selected by the Faculty or Department based on their academic performance, with no application process required. The award is presented during the Fall term to honor the graduating student's exceptional academic accomplishments.
